## Formula sandbox tuning

User-supplied formulas in Gridmoor execute inside a restricted interpreter with hard ceilings on time, memory, and call depth. Reviewers should confirm any change to these ceilings is justified in the PR description, since raising them widens the abuse surface. Defaults were chosen from production traces. The current limits are as follows.

limits module of tafog-fawip:
WEIGHTS = {
    "julix": 57,
    "lamys": 992,
    "kasvan": 209,
    "quenok": 750,
    "alddor": 259,
    "oliath": 1009,
    "wenix": 815,
}

Hi Orla,

Before you review the Glimmerbox autocomplete patch: the index rebuild was crawling because we re-tokenized on every keystroke. The fix batches updates and it's noticeably snappier in staging. Should be a quick approve. To push the signed index artifact yourself after merging, you'll need the deploy key, which I've pasted below.

rollout seal: bky4_DFM9

Finance Review — Pilot Summary. The Kestrelmart pilot ran eight weeks across four Norvale branches. Revenue per shelf unit beat forecast by 6%; returns stayed under 2%. Fixture costs came in high; logistics flagged delivery windows as the main friction point. Kestrelmart has asked for terms on a wider rollout before quarter close. Hold all pricing discussions until head office confirms the framework. Full figures follow next week. The note below outlines the plan going forward.

management briefing: Project Ulavan slips by two quarters because of the staffing delay.

Security review should verify the new scoped-credential design before the next release: the scheduler must only enqueue digests, with the Larkhenge sender service performing the actual dispatch under its own identity. Confirm audit logging covers schedule mutations and that stale locks expire within five minutes. The proposed permission model and threat notes are written up on the internal page here.

operations page: https://jenkins.zemvarcloud.local/job/merge_requests/repo/build/73930b4b30f0a8ed